kamihamster wrote: Mon Jun 18, 2018 9:00 amAs the manager of your team, you not only have to look at your lineup and asses it's strengths and weakness, you have to look at your opponent too. Sometimes it will be obvious, sometimes it wont be. But it's a fun way to try to stack the deck in your favor. As the visiting team, you probably will be exploited for your teams weakness, and after the 5th team does that format to you, you probably will be really motivated to shore up that weakness. It should create more trading. It will make the playoffs more intense and that home field advantage will really be a thing in the play offs, where as its meaningless right now. I see more fun coming out of this format than not. It just wont be feasible until MFL makes it a part of their platform.
This description makes me like it even more. I've been trying to find a way to make being the home team relevant , too.

I would also be intrigued to see a league that plays typical head to head with divsions, playoffs, league champ, etc. Business as usual.

HOWEVER:

It also gives a worthwhile/substantial weekly cash payout to the highest best ball score.

I think it would make roster construction VERY strategic. Kickers, DSTs, backup QBs would increase in value a lot as owners would want to hold them for the best ball potential reward. I would personally always have at least 2 kickers & 2 DSTs on my team. I would also want players like Taylor Gabriel on my team as they could blow up an 80 yard TD randomly. There would be an opportunity cost to hold these type of players obviously as your roster cap would force you to make sacrifices elsewhere.
